Output 88c885d3d8d98a2a9fc8db1796428e5b0234e58e556c62a88e676e33eab27929:42

value
89437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df23b95deba3edd4e4b74e1bfb263d69d7226e70 OP_EQUAL
address
3N2sQUWmFDEEF8iBzU43PE5LMth2M4Q3Dd
transaction
88c885d3d8d98a2a9fc8db1796428e5b0234e58e556c62a88e676e33eab27929
spent
true